So, 'Let's Roll' is this quirky little comedy that doesn't take itself too seriously but also manages to have some heart. The film revolves around two dykes stuck in their driveway, trying to escape for a vacation. It's got this laid-back vibe, almost like a slice-of-life piece, but with a lot of humor derived from their banter and the absurdity of the situation. The pacing is pretty steady, not rushed, allowing the characters to breathe and the comedic moments to land properly. The performances are genuine, adding to that offbeat charm. Also, it's not laden with flashy effects; it’s all about character dynamics and that relatable experience of plans going hilariously awry.
